Victor matrix B-23942. Rose of Washington Square / Sidney Phillips
| Title | Source |
|---|---|
| Rose of Washington Square (Primary title) | Victor ledgers |
| Ziegfeld midnight frolic (Work title) | Victor ledgers |
| Authors and Composers | Notes |
| Ballard MacDonald (lyricist) | |
| James F. Hanley (composer) | |
| Composer information source: Victor ledgers. | |
| Personnel | Notes |
| Sidney Phillips (vocalist : baritone vocal) | |
| Josef Pasternack (conductor) | |
Additional Information
- Description: Male vocal solo, with orchestra
- Category: Vocal
- Language: English
- Master Size: 10-in.
| Take Date and Place | Take | Status | Label Name/Number | Note |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 4/16/1920 Camden, New Jersey | 1 | Hold/destroy | ||
| 4/16/1920 Camden, New Jersey | 2 | Destroy | ||
| 4/16/1920 Camden, New Jersey | 3 | Master/destroy |
